Definition of Mission Control no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

Mission Control

noun
 
/ˌmɪʃn kənˈtrəʊl/
 
/ˌmɪʃn kənˈtrəʊl/
[singular + singular or plural verb]
jump to other results
  1. the people on earth who control and communicate with the people on a flight into space
    • This is Mission Control calling the space shuttle Discovery.
    • The spacecraft lost contact with Mission Control.
    • Mission Control is/are investigating the problem.
